Neighbourhood externalities

Adam Gurri provides a moral challenge to Paretean welfare economics.
All this only works if you think one preference is just as good as another, and maximizing preferences is a wonderful goal for a moral philosophy. I, for one, think that this is a terrible goal for morality, especially taken in isolation.
My favorite example of this model’s utter failure to provide a sufficient moral compass comes from the play A Raisin in the Sun. In it, an African-American family seeks to move to a predominantly white, affluent suburban neighborhood. You can probably guess where this is going: the people who already lived there did not want this family as their neighbors. From an economics point of view, the family was imposing an externality on their racist neighbors. What’s more, the real historical phenomenon of “white flight” in such cases actually reduced demand for housing in the neighborhoods that were being fled. As a result, the housing prices fell in the neighborhoods that African-Americans moved into, making the existence of a formally-defined externality undeniable.
I challenge the committed Pigovian to explain to me how this is anything other than a clear-cut externality, and how they can avoid the conclusion that their model would have them impose a tax on the African-American family. Moreover, libertarians aren’t in a much better position, morally. In A Raisin in the Sun, we get to see an actual Coasian bargain in action—-the white neighbors pool their resources to offer to buy out the African-American family from the house. Without spoiling the plot, I can’t say that the fact that this is a voluntary bargain inclines me to believe that the preference of the bargainers are on equal moral footing.
The philosophy of maximizing preferences does not distinguish between the family seeking the opportunity to rise above their circumstances and the racists who hate them.
While I'm more than happy to condemn the racist neighbours, I don't think the example provides that strong a case against standard economics.

The baseline is liberal: the African-American family is able to buy the house. The neighbours haven't been able to appeal to some notion of "neighbourhood character" to ban them from moving next door. Despite potentially high transactions costs, the neighbours were able to buy them out, indicating that their actual willingness to pay to be horrible racists was pretty high.

Gurri suggests that the main policy conclusion would be "tax the African-American" family; Coase reminds us that Pigovean externality-taxation solutions are not the only way of enabling Paretean welfare economics, and that the direction of the externality is always a bit up for debate. We could equally note the substantial negative externality the racists place on the incoming family and tax them for it. And in this case the Coasean solution obtained without any policy imposition: the neighbours bought out the incoming family.

I haven't read the play, but based only on the snippet above, I'd have written a Sylvester McMonkey McBean style conclusion: the outgoing family would tell their friends about these crazy racists who are willing to buy you out, at a premium, if you buy a house in their neighbourhood. Eventually, the entrepreneurs would drain the racists of any continued ability to pay for racism.

And while I'll agree with Gurri that any of us coming from particular philosophical perspectives will have sets of preferences that they view as better than others' preferences, having something other than a Paretean set-up for policy requires picking winners among competing values. Even leaving aside the substantial problems Cowen points to in his chapter on non-Paretean welfare standards, we have another simpler, but important, issue. In the play, the neighbours had to demonstrate a real willingness to pay for racism.

In the alternative, in which we move away from Paretean welfare economics, we need some voting apparatus to overturn willingness-to-pay and choice as basis for assessing whether a move has improved welfare. And racism is cheaper at the ballot-box than it is in the real world. It is far easier to imagine neighbourhoods being willing to vote for measures that would ban particular types of people from being able to buy houses, or lodging objections on notified consents, than it is to imagine their actually being willing to buy those people out. If actual willingness to pay is less than the amount necessary to change the outcome, then the externality is not Pareto-relevant.

I'd written on psychic externalities a few years ago:
I'm reminded of Jennifer Roback's work showing how southern racists were able to achieve at the ballot box segregation outcomes they were unable to achieve in the market. To recap: racist southern whites wanted segregated streetcars. But it was too expensive for the streetcar companies to run segregated cars: the increased ticket revenues from white racists didn't compensate sufficiently for lost black custom and, especially, increased running costs. White racists effectively weren't willing to pay enough for tickets to segregated streetcars, so the market didn't provide them. But casting a racist ballot is individually costless. And so streetcar segregation was mandated through regulation.

When I see folks going to the ballot box to enforce their preferences over other peoples' activities, my general presumption is that transactions costs isn't what's keeping meddlers from seeking less coercive options. The ballot box is just cheaper when a majority has weakly meddlesome preferences, regardless of efficiency.
Where illiberal preferences are weakly but broadly held, overturning the results of voluntary choice through use of a non-Paretean framework risks intervening to address externalities that are not Pareto-relevant, with greater illiberalism as result. If, on the other hand, illiberal preferences were very strongly held among a very well-heeled minority, results could flip.

Don't start by assuming stupidity

Suppose that you want to reduce petrol usage because of global warming.

If you begin from an assumption of consumer rationality, you'll prefer a carbon tax or some form of emission trading. Announce today a schedule of Pigovean carbon taxes and how they will affect petrol prices as they ramp up over time. Then let customers decide how to re-optimise when buying cars. We'd expect an increase in demand for cars with better fuel economy. Cars with worse fuel economy will start having to sell at a discount. Manufacturers adjust their product mix to account for changing demand and aggregate fleet composition changes over the longer term.

If you start from an assumption of consumer stupidity, you'll prefer regulations targeting car manufacturers mandating fuel economy standards. If car buyers are myopic and stupid, they'll fail to account for the higher lifetime cost of a car with worse fuel economy. Because customers are stupid in this way, manufacturers will not adjust their product mix to shift towards cars with better fuel economy - there's no change in demand for more efficient cars even with a well-publicised schedule of future tax increases. And so direct regulation has to be used. There are problems with this and lots of them - all the gaming of US CAFE standards and redefinitions of what constitutes a truck as most obvious example. But it could be a second best if car buyers are really stupid. Or, if they're just really really short-sighted. We'll also have to assume that car buyers do not change their behaviour by a lot when the price of driving a kilometer goes down by a lot.

What happens if we look to the data? Busse et al in the latest American Economic Review find pretty good evidence that car buyers' demand for fuel economy is sensitive to petrol prices. They conclude (ungated versions):

We estimated that a $1 increase in the price of gasoline increases the market share of cars in the highest fuel economy quartile by 21.1 percent and decreases the market share of cars in the lowest fuel economy quartile by 27.1 percent. We also estimated the effect of a $1 increase in gasoline prices on unit sales of new cars and found that sales in the highest fuel economy quartile increased by 10–12 percent, while sales in the lowest fuel economy quartile fell by 27–28 percent. We estimated the effect of gasoline prices on the equilibrium prices of new cars and found that a $1 increase in the price of gasoline is associated with an increase of $354 in the average price of the highest fuel economy quartile of cars relative to that of the lowest fuel economy quartile. For used cars, the estimated relative price difference is $1,945.
We used these estimates to investigate whether the changes in equilibrium prices for new and used cars associated with changes in gasoline prices show evidence that consumers undervalue future gasoline costs of cars with different fuel economies relative to the prices of those cars. This could be thought of as a necessary condition for effective policy: the more car buyers discount future fuel costs, the less effective a gasoline tax or carbon tax will be in influencing vehicle choice. Using several different assumptions about vehicle miles traveled, a range of assumptions about the elasticity of demand, and comparing the relative price differences between different quartiles, we find little evidence of consumer myopia. Many of our implicit discount rates are near zero; most are less than 20 percent.
So the "people aren't stupid and weigh costs over time in a sensible fashion" model seems the better baseline approach.

Now imagine that you set a fuel economy standard instead of a carbon/petrol tax in a world where customers are forward-looking and not idiots. Well, once they've bought the more efficient car, the value they derive from burning another litre of petrol increases substantially: they can drive farther, and they're not charged any more for that litre of petrol. And so a lot of the reductions in carbon emission you might have expected get whittled away by that people drive more. If you'd done it instead with a petrol tax, the marginal cost of another litre of petrol is higher. People still flip to the more efficient vehicle, but petrol usage doesn't rebound as much as consequence because the marginal cost of a litre is higher.

Tax maximisation, smoking, and the Stalin Gap

If my lifestyle and leisure choices lead me to remit less to the government in taxes than I would have under alternative scenarios, have I imposed an externality on the State?

James Meanwell asks:
Eric, care to weigh in on a debate I'm having about this elsewhere? Specifically, does loss of tax revenue as a result of lower productivity (e.g. due to smoking, eating too much) count as an externality? I've argued that the government would have to be spending efficiently, which is unlikely, for the loss of revenue to count as an externality and so it probably doesn't (count). Not sure if that's right, but the notion (i.e. loss-of-revenue-due-to-lower-productivity-as-externality) seems odd to me.
I started replying to his comment, but reckoned it deserved its own post.

Let's start with the big picture and work down to details.

Consider two people, alike in relevant ways at age 10 and equal in earnings potential, but with different utility functions. So they make different choices.

Mr. A decides that the rat race isn't for him and decides instead to take a part-time job at 20 hours per week instead of 40. Were he to have worked a full time job, his earnings would have doubled and, because of progressive taxation, his tax payments would have more than doubled. But he's not on welfare; he just can transform relatively little income into a fair bit of happiness because he really likes leisure.

Mr. B does not enjoy sitting idle; he consumes his leisure by smoking while working a full-time job. Associated health issues reduce his productivity and, as consequence, he earns a quarter less than he otherwise would; his tax payments are then perhaps a third lower than they otherwise could have been. Other sources have a lower wage penalty for smoking; we'll stick with a big one for present purposes.

If Mr. B's lower tax payments because of his choice to smoke are of policy consequence, then so too are Mr. A's lower tax payments because of his choices. Indeed, we could say that Mr. A is far worse than Mr. B: while Mr. B pays, in New Zealand, about three times as much in tobacco excise as he'll cost the public health system and is so kind as to die before costing the superannuation system very much, Mr A pays zero tax on his leisure and will earn two-thirds of the national average wage in his retirement despite having contributed relatively little to the superannuation system.

If we need to use policy to nudge Mr. B into smoking less, because of reduced tax earnings, then we also need to nudge Mr. A into working harder. And when nudges don't work in tobacco and start becoming shoves, we need to start shoving Mr. A as well.

Mancur Olson argued that Stalinist Russia had the world's most effective extractive tax regime. Workers were effectively compelled to work by near complete inframarginal taxation combined with very low taxation at the margin. If Stalin had had the ability to solve the Socialist Calculation Problem, he could have done slightly better, leaving each worker with an individualised menu of two choices: starvation, or a personalised bundle of very hard work and some goods leaving the worker epsilon better off than under starvation. I suppose that we could consider any deviation from that level of work as a harm imposed on the state. But it's only Stalin who'd really want to push there.

The Okun Gap is the difference between potential and realised GDP due to excess unemployment. I'll call the Stalin Gap the difference between an individual's potential maximal tax payments and his actual tax payments based on his choice to consume leisure over labour - partially because he would choose some leisure even in the absence of taxes, partially because too high of income tax rates yields substitution to leisure.

Most of us could earn more, and consequently submit higher tax payments, by choosing more labour and less leisure. But we'd be less happy.

So that's the big picture: the world in which the smoker's lower income tax payments (ignoring his much much higher excise tax payments) are sufficient basis for taking away his leisure is one where we want to penalize people for taking holidays or failing to work as many hours as they otherwise could: closing the Stalin Gap. Unless we say that leisure via time off relaxing is, by assumption, good, while leisure via smoking is bad - but that remains question-begging.

Smaller picture: is this even an externality?


Short answer: likely, but likely very small, and that small portion mostly because of how the tax system treats poor people.

All right. An individual chooses between smoking, leisure and labour. In a world with private health care and no taxation, the individual optimally balances health harms from smoking against enjoyment of smoking - he earns less because he smokes, but that's just part of the full cost of tobacco that he enters into his optimisation. All you behavioural guys who want to complain about whether he can be rational or informed on this can shut up for the moment - we're trying to figure out whether he's imposing an externality on the government once we move to a tax regime, so the behavioural stuff is entirely beside the point.

Some optimal level of smoking will be found above. What happens when we add taxation and government? The smoker will bear fewer of the wage costs of smoking because the government takes a portion of his earnings and so he should optimally smoke more. But again, the same is true of the individual's choice to consume other forms of leisure in the presence of income taxation. Recall that in economics, we don't care about externalities because of pecuniary effects like "the government gets less in tax". We care about them rather because they distort choices: people move from taxed labour to untaxed leisure in the presence of income taxation. The incremental increase in smoking when the returns to labour drop under a taxation regime can be viewed as a distortion. But, again, think of anything that helps increase the marginal utility of leisure. In a world with taxes and government, people choose more days off playing cheap but excellent video games relative to the zero-tax world. What then is the productivity cost of video games? Or of any other kind of leisure? It's hard for me to see any productivity externality of smoking that is different in kind from any other labour-leisure distortion generated by taxation. And it would take some number crunching to show that the technological portion of any effect* here isn't already over-internalised by current levels of tobacco excise.

Gordon Tullock reminded us in 1998 that government produces externalities as well as solving some externality problems. The vast bulk of reduced income taxation accruing to government due to smoking could only be remedied by imposing harms on smokers that are larger than the potential gains to government. Now, if you want to assume that smokers are irrational and hurting themselves by their choice to smoke, you can do that, but you don't really need the effects on income taxation to make the case.

Recall that smoking is concentrated among poorer cohorts and that marginal tax rates, though not average tax rates, are very high for the poor. If the deadweight costs of high marginal tax rates are making poor people smoke more than they otherwise would because the personal income losses are low, they're probably also screwing up a whole lot of other choices that are of greater consequence as well. If you're going to worry about it, start by trying to fix the tax schedule and abatement rates for the various income-contingent benefits so that the effective marginal tax rates facing poor families are not insanely high.

The Ministry for Social Development noted that 35% of beneficiaries (people receiving benefits other than just Working for Families, NZ's EITC) in paid work in 2008 enjoyed effective marginal tax rates higher than 75%, with some non-beneficiary low income families enduring abatement of the minimum family tax credit facing EMTRs over 100%. MSD concluded dryly, "Work incentives are very low for such families".


Effective marginal tax rates in excess of 75% are very likely to induce all sorts of very real distortions in behaviour; I expect the decision to smoke incrementally more because of reduced returns to wages is pretty trivial in this mess.



* Again, we don't care about externalities that are pecuniary. Imagine that the smoker smokes exactly as much under a tax regime as under a no-tax regime. The government earns less than it would were the smoker a non-smoker, but this is purely pecuniary: the gain to the government by forcing him to quit would be overmatched by the losses experienced by the smoker. The only portion that can matter for welfare is the excess smoking induced by the lower return to labour under the tax regime. And that's unlikely to be large relative to the amount of smoking that's invariant to income tax rates.

Environmentalist Calculation [updated]

Suppose that you care about reducing carbon dioxide emissions. Should you:
a) implement a low carbon tax across all carbon dioxide emissions, or
b) subsidize solar power?

I've argued before that, absent comprehensive Pigovean taxation, you can get nonsense.

So, if you answered b, here's a nice little example of exactly that kind of nonsense.
Preliminary evidence shows some solar stations may have run diesel-burning generators and sold the output as solar power, which earns several times more than electricity from fossil fuels, El Mundo said, citing unidentified people from the energy industry. The power grid received 4,500 megawatt-hours of power from midnight to 7 a.m. in the months audited, El Mundo said.
Yes, this was fraud, and fraud could well also be a problem for a carbon tax. But it's hard to see how they could have pulled this one off if there were a carbon tax on diesel (and all other sources) rather than a subsidy to solar power. One wag suggested that the solar companies could have stayed within the letter of the law by using the diesel generators to power huge spotlights, which they'd then shine on the solar panels at night. This would never make sense under a carbon tax, but would be eminently rational if the solar subsidy were high enough.

Conditional on wanting to do something to reduce emissions, Club Pigou remains your best bet.

Update: Note, of course, all of the problems with Pigovean solutions relative to Coasean ones. Patri helpfully posts a reminder. In short, when the Pigovean solution is efficient, we're unlikely to get it because political processes will push us to cap & trade or other systems that benefit incumbents. And, if we got a Pigovean carbon tax, it's exceedingly unlikely that we'd have commensurate reductions in other tax rates; much of the collected taxes will be wasted.
